Rental market highlights
As of June 2026, the average rent in Flowery Branch, GA is $2,100 per month, which is 9% higher than the national average rent of $1,930 per month.

As of June 2026, apartments are the most affordable rental option in Flowery Branch, GA at $1,826 per month, while houses are the most expensive at $2,385 per month. Townhomes average $2,065 per month, offering a mid-range alternative for renters.
Average rent by number of bedrooms
| Floor plan type | Average rent |
|---|---|
| 1 Bedroom | $1,416 |
| 2 Bedrooms | $1,636 |
| 3 Bedrooms | $2,067 |
| 4 Bedrooms | $2,400 |
| All | $2,100 |
As of June 2026, the average rent for a 1 bedroom rental in Flowery Branch, GA is $1,416 per month, followed by $1,636 for a 2 bedroom rental, $2,067 for a 3 bedroom rental, and $2,400 for a 4 bedroom rental.
